Lot 30 of 465: A George IV silver vinaigrette, of rectangular shape, ribbed body, cast foliage edge and engine turned geometric designed cover, rectangular cartouche to centre engraved P.G, grill and sponge inside and gilt interior, hallmarked by Thomas & William Simpson, Birmingham, circa 1822 (marks nearly ineligible), approx. 3.5cm wide x 0.8cm high.
